I have managed to accrue second copies of all of Paul Smith's issues of Uncanny except for 167. Once I have them together, I'm thinking of sending them to be bound in a cheap hardcover. Research of the prices makes me think it'll be in and around the $30.00 mark.

Anyone else ever done this or considered it? I wouldn't do it with my good copies, obviously.... but sometimes moving boxes around to pull issues out for re-reading is a pain in the ass.
